Abstract
The invention discloses a kind of rain shelter cultivation methods for being exclusively used in grape and asparagus interplanting, take sandy soil in wine-growing garden, sandy soil are piled earth ridge, the earth ridge two sides are provided with gutter;Grape is planted in the center of the earth ridge, and asparagus is planted close to the position in the gutter in the earth ridge two sides, there are several support frames by being distributed in the gutter of all earth ridges in length and breadth, each support frame on ordinate is in same gutter and the distance between adjacent for 4.8-5m, each support frame on horizontal line is in different gutters and the distance between adjacent for 5.2-5.7 meters, support frame as described above is higher than the earth ridge 2-2.2m, support frame as described above top is provided with the grape trellis for facilitating grapevine to wind, arch rain-proof shelter corresponding with each earth ridge is provided on support frame;Hydrojet was corrected to grape in 14-16 days before grape maturity, solution on grape is waited to air-dry rear bagging.

Technical field
The present invention relates to field of planting more particularly to a kind of rain shelter cultivation methods for being exclusively used in grape and asparagus interplanting.
Background technique
Interplanting refers in the later period of former plant growth, recur it is reserved in the ranks or one kind with other crops of intercrop
Planting patterns.China is in vegetable growing using relatively more early and universal.It had been widely used on field crop in recent years,
The area that especially Henan, Shandong, Hebei etc. save the interplantings such as wheat and cotton, wheat and corn, wheat and peanut account for 70-80% with
On.This mode improves the utilization rate in soil, to also increase the income of peasant.
In actual planting process, due to the invasion of rainwater, the yield decline of grape and asparagus will lead to, and pass through rain
The grape of water erosion is easy disease and whitens maize ear rot, blight dis-ease, anthracnose etc..

Summary of the invention
Technical problem to be solved by the present invention lies in provide one kind with defect in view of the deficiencies of the prior art and be exclusively used in
The rain shelter cultivation method of grape and asparagus interplanting.
Technical problem solved by the invention can be realized using following technical scheme:
A kind of rain shelter cultivation method being exclusively used in grape and asparagus interplanting, takes sandy soil in wine-growing garden, by sandy soil heap
At earth ridge, the earth ridge two sides are provided with gutter;Grape is planted in the center of the earth ridge, and in the earth ridge two sides
Plant asparagus in position close to the gutter, which is characterized in that there are several support frames by the draining for being distributed all earth ridges in length and breadth
In ditch, each support frame on ordinate is in same gutter and the distance between adjacent for 4.8-5m, is located at horizontal line
On each support frame be in different gutters and the distance between adjacent for 5.2-5.7 meter, support frame as described above is higher than institute
State earth ridge 2-2.2m, support frame as described above top is provided with the grape trellis for facilitating grapevine to wind, be provided on support frame with it is each
The corresponding arch rain-proof shelter of earth ridge;Hydrojet was corrected to grape in 14-16 days before grape maturity, after solution air-dries on waiting grape
Bagging.
In a preferred embodiment of the invention, support frame as described above is made of steel pipe, and the grape trellis is the friendship of two steel pipes
It pitches, two steel pipe is separately connected adjacent symmetrical support frame, and the crosspoint of the grape trellis is located at the vine
Surface;Arch rain-proof shelter center between each grape trellis being arranged on the same earth ridge at a distance from be
0.5-0.6m。
In a preferred embodiment of the invention, each vine is surrounded by a limit rhizosphere column, and each limit rhizosphere column is
It at limit rhizosphere column described in a circle is plastics fence centered on one plant of vine, dense distribution air hole on the plastics fence,
The diameter on the limit rhizosphere column is 1.5-1.6m, and the spacing on each limit rhizosphere column is 2.8-3m, is covered with one in the limit rhizosphere column
Layer cultivates soil, and the vine is planted in the cultivation soil.
In a preferred embodiment of the invention, the manufacturing process for cultivating soil: the sandy soil in plantation is taken to carry out
Broken to shine soil white, and applies decomposed manure 3000-4000kg per acre and plant ash 100-200kg is stirred mixing per acre
It is native at cultivating;The decomposed manure includes vinasse after sandy soil, rare earth, mushroom particle, dish cottonrose hibiscus, Wine-making, grape branch
Bud and organic fertilizer.
In a preferred embodiment of the invention, vine maintenance processes: vine growth season terminates in the Portugal Ru Dongqian
Then the root of grape tree covers the cultivation soil of a thickness 2-3cm with rice straw mulching, while major branch viny being cut, and only stays
Lower twig;In decomposed manure of addition in spring and compound fertilizer, and the quantity of leaf on newborn major branch is controlled, repaired weekly
It cuts 1 time, guarantees the sunshine-duration viny;Summer guarantee is regularly applied fertilizer, while the quality in order to guarantee vine fruit ear, fixed
Phase controls yield viny to branches and leaves trimming.
In a preferred embodiment of the invention, the compound fertilizer is 45% nitrogen, phosphorus, potassium three element compound fertilizer.
In a preferred embodiment of the invention, the bagging is the waterproof bag for selecting wood pulp paper production;Before bagging
Vine to wipe out small ear, top fringe and extract granule, infected seed, then spray again 25% 1000-1500 times of liquid of Fluoxastrobin suspending agent,
The mixed solution of 20% 1500-2000 times of difenoconazole water dispersible granule liquid, solution to be mixed start bagging after air-drying.
Due to using technical solution as above, the beneficial effects of the present invention are: arch rain-proof shelter can guarantee grape
Tree reduces disease incidence viny, and a more step after mixed liquor and bagging is cooperated to reduce vine not by rain erosion
Disease incidence;It ensure that the yield and quality of grape.
